Many bird enthusiasts enjoyed a bird box making workshop in Marlow.

Hosted by Wild Marlow at the Pavilion in Little Marlow on Saturday, January 11, people both young and old had fun making their bird houses, which saw 31 get made on the day.

Verity West of Wild Marlow said: “The event was a huge success as we had some great feedback and everyone thoroughly enjoyed themselves.”

Wild Marlow are a group of enthusiasts who are passionate about wildlife and protecting biodiversity in the Marlow area.

They share their passion for wildlife by engaging the community through events, competitions, volunteering and work parties to raise awareness of the importance of a balanced ecosystem.
